#429345 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#429345 is composed of 25.9% red, 57.6% green and 27.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 53.1% yellow and 42.4% black. It has a hue angle of 122.2 degrees, a saturation of 38% and a lightness of 41.8%. #429345 color hex could be obtained by blending #84ff8a with #002700.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

#429345 color description : Dark moderate lime green.

#429345 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#429345 has RGB values of R:66, G:147, B:69 and CMYK values of C:0.55, M:0, Y:0.53,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 4363077.

Shades and Tints of #429345

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050c05 is the darkest color, while #fdf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#429345

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#637263 is the less saturated color, while #00d508 is the most saturated one.
